Honesty was written and recorded by Billy Joel. It was released in 1979 on the 52nd Street album. In this lesson, we’ll talk about the 13 different triads used in the song. Some of them are played with an added 6 or 7 and many are played with bass notes other than the root – so we’ll cover slash chords – these slash chords are a big part of Billy Joel’s style. As usual, we’ll first go through each part of the song with chords in root position – then follow that up by using the technique of finding the nearest inversion. In the song specific techniques section, I’ll take you through the song front to back – detailing the Intro, Outro, and many of the signature licks in the song.
